Building a Strong Profile that Attracts the Right Match

Your profile is the first impression you give to potential partners. For Alabama farmers, authenticity shines. Here’s how to craft a profile that stands out:

Choose Photos that Tell Your Story

  1. Show your farm – A picture of you beside a tractor or in a field signals your lifestyle.
  2. Include a candid moment – A photo of you laughing at a county fair or feeding chickens adds warmth.
  3. Keep it recent – Use images from the past year so matches know what you look like now.

Write a Bio that Highlights Compatibility

Mention your daily routine: “I rise before sunrise to check the milking cows, then head to the market on Fridays.”
Share your passions: “I love listening to classic country on the porch after a long day.”
State what you’re looking for: “Seeking a partner who values hard work, family, and a good potluck dinner.”
